摘 要:目的:观察逍遥散对慢性束缚应激肝郁脾虚证焦虑模型大鼠血清炎性因子白介素(interleukin,IL-1β)、IL-6、肿瘤坏死因子-α(tumor necrosis factor,TNF-α)的影响,以此研究逍遥散的干预作用。方法:28只雄性SD大鼠随机分为正常组、模型组、逍遥散组、氟西汀组;正常组不做任何处理,模型组、逍遥散组和氟西汀组通过连续14天慢性束缚应激建立肝郁脾虚证焦虑模型,逍遥散组和氟西汀组于每天上午束缚前分别灌服逍遥散混悬液(0.006 1 g·g-1)以及氟西汀(0.002mg·g-1),正常组和模型组灌服去离子水。第15天,观察各组大鼠的宏观表征、体质量变化、新环境进食抑制实验,高架十字迷宫实验。第16天,用ELISA方法测定大鼠血清的IL-1β、IL-6、TNF-α的变化。结果:实验第15天模型组的行为学均明显变化。体质量:正常组、模型组、逍遥散组和氟西汀组分别为(353.14±5.80)g、(334.17±5.18)g、(353.95±8.00)g、(355.65±4.92)g,模型组明显低于其余3组(P<0.05);新环境进食抑制实验:正常组、模型组、逍遥散组和氟西汀组分别为(1.151±0.50)min、(3.48±0.53)min、(1.29±0.25)min、(1.85±0.25)min,模型组明显高于其余3组(P<0.05,P<0.01);高架十字迷宫实验:开放臂进入次数的正常组、模型组、逍遥散组和氟西汀组分别为(3.86±0.67)次、(1.28±0.68)次、(4.28±0.94)次、(3.86±0.85)次,开放臂停留时间的正常组、模型组、逍遥散组和氟西汀组分别为(15.46±6.72)s、(0.17±0.11)s、(12.38±4.27)s、(11.33±2.01)s,与正常组比较,开放臂进入次数与开放臂停留时间的逍遥散组及氟西汀组大鼠无统计学差异(P>0.05)。与模型组相比,除氟西汀组开放臂停留时间以外,其余3组大鼠的开放臂进入次数与开放臂停留时间均高于模型组(P<0.05);正常组IL-1β、IL-6、TNF-α分别为(28.20±7.53)ng·L-1、(26.70±8.86)ng·L-1、(67.65±6.73)ng·L-1,模型组IL-1β、IL-6、TNF-α分别为(91.50±28.70)ng·L-1Objective: This experiment was designed to measure the affect of Xiao Yao San on treating liver depression and spleen deficiency syndrome anxiety by recording the changes of inflammatory factor IL^-1β,IL-6,TNF-α levels in the blood serum in chronic immobilization stress( CIS) model rats. Methods: 28 male SD rats were randomly divided into 4 groups: normal group,model group,Xiao Yao San group and fluoxetine group. We didn't do any processing in normal group,but model,Xiao Yao San and fluoxetine groups by continuous 14 days immobilization stress induced liver depression and spleen deficiency syndrome anxiety,before every morning bondage administered Xiao Yao San( 0. 006 1 g·g- 1) to the Xiao Yao San group,fluoxetine( 0. 002 mg·g- 1) to the fluoxetine group and administered a deionized water to the normal and model groups. After 15 days,we observed macro characterization,weight change,elevated plus maze and novelty suppressed feeding tests. We used ELISA to measure IL^-1β,IL-6,TNF-αlevels in blood serum of rats after death on day 16 Results: The model group of 15 days of behavioral changes significantly.
